Output d81f12dd1bd5f863539865334873dcb3ea1320d3b6be6c643766b11bf89c3b60:7

value
1098091658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12803500e0a662b6429f6f0a341635b23f079d5b OP_EQUAL
address
M9ayys7KbwWY72GJL1UhomQynFxJKHTGxN
transaction
d81f12dd1bd5f863539865334873dcb3ea1320d3b6be6c643766b11bf89c3b60
spent
true